Last updated: 2024 Jun 14Morning
Start your day with a visit to Canada's Wonderland , a popular amusement park located just outside of Toronto. Enjoy thrilling roller coasters, water rides, and live entertainment.
Afternoon
Head to Roundhouse Park , a historic railway park located in downtown Toronto. Explore the restored locomotives and take a ride on the miniature train. Afterward, take a walk along the Toronto Harbour and enjoy the scenic views of Lake Ontario.
Morning
Take a stroll along the shores of Lake Ontario and enjoy the beautiful waterfront views. Explore the vibrant Toronto Chinatown and indulge in some delicious Chinese cuisine.
Afternoon
Visit the Scotiabank Arena (Air Canada Centre) , a multi-purpose indoor arena that hosts concerts, sporting events, and more. Take a tour of the venue and learn about its history.
Morning
Explore the beautiful Queen's Park , a historic park located in the heart of Toronto. Take a leisurely walk and admire the sculptures and gardens.
Afternoon
Relax at Sugar Beach , a waterfront park with sandy beaches and pink umbrellas. Enjoy a picnic or take a dip in the lake.
Morning
Explore the vibrant Entertainment District , home to theaters, restaurants, and nightlife. Catch a show or enjoy a meal at one of the many dining options.
Afternoon
Visit the Distillery Historic District , a pedestrian-only village with Victorian-era buildings that have been transformed into shops, restaurants, and galleries. Take a guided tour to learn about its history.
Morning
Experience breathtaking views of the city from the CN Tower , one of the tallest freestanding structures in the world. Take a ride in the glass elevator to the observation deck and enjoy panoramic views.
Afternoon
Discover the wonders of the underwater world at Ripley's Aquarium of Canada . Explore the interactive exhibits and get up close with marine life.
Morning
Explore the bustling St. Lawrence Market , one of Toronto's oldest and most popular food markets. Sample local produce, baked goods, and international delicacies.
Afternoon
Take a ferry ride to the Toronto Islands , a group of small islands located just off the coast of downtown Toronto. Enjoy a picnic, rent a bike, or relax on the beach.
